I have a DLL - mSQL.dll from the MiniSQL package at
http://www.hughes.com.au - for which I want to generate an import library
for use with the egcs 1.1 compiler. I can't get dlltool to do what I want.
I need basically the same behaviour I'd get from Watcom's wlink
- input a DLL
- output an import lib with stubs for all exported functions.
Can I do this? Do I have to write a manual DEF file with an entry for each
export? Do I then have to work out the size of the parameters and set the
suffix to @4, @8 etc? This is how I got the Bullet library at
http://www.40th.com - very fast database engine -working some time ago, and
I don't fancy it for the whole mSQL API. I just want to use the mSQL.dll
functions in my code while using the egcs compiler - is it possible?
